(1) Outputs share terminals with digital inputs. You must choose between inputs or outputs.
(2) Digital inputs can be use as pulse inputs.
(3) Some digital inputs can be use as pulse inputs.
(4) One anlog input can be connected directly to a PT100 sensor.
All GRD models have a USB communication port. This port is used to configure the GRD.
For the connection with the PC a type “B” USB standard cable is used.

The GRD has 3 LEDs indicators.
PWR: Power applied to the GRD
GPRS: State of registration of the GRD in the GPRS network
LINK: State of the connection between the GRD and the Middleware

For the correct operation of the equipment the SIM card (or chip) must meet the following requirements:
A subscription to GSM and GPRS services
It must be cleared to be installed in any equipment (some SIM cards can only be installed in the equipment where they were purchased).
Verify the telephone number assigned to the SIM Card.
You must know the data to access the GPRS network of the telephone operator corresponding to the SIM card (APN, user, password). These data are preloaded in the GRD for Movistar Argentina, Telecom Personal Argentina and Claro Argentina. If you use another operator please contact support@exemys.com.
If the PIN (security code) of the SIM Card is activated you must enter it into the GRD when requested.
